Beágyazott Linux állományrendszerek összehasonlítása

OData támogatás
Konzulens:
Bányász Gábor
Automatizálási és Alkalmazott Informatikai Tanszék

Napjainkban a beágyazott rendszereket egyre több helyen, és egyre

többféle területen alkalmazzák. Ez részben az IoT (Internet of Things,

,,Tárgyak Internete'') robbanásszerű terjedésének és fejlődésének

köszönhető, amihez többféle beágyazott eszközt használnak mérési és

egyszerűbb vezérlési feladatok ellátására. Ezen rendszerek az általános

célú társaikhoz képest jelentősen alacsonyabb számítási teljesítménnyel

rendelkeznek, ugyanakkor a költségük is sokkal alacsonyabb.

A beágyazott rendszerek a tervezés minden fázisában és területén külön

figyelmet igényelnek, ugyanis a lehetőségek és az elvárások nagyon

különböznek a megszokottól. Ez igaz a háttértár kialakítására is, mind a

fizikai, mind a szoftveres részét tekintve. Legtöbbször kis területű

flash alapú tárolót használnak, aminek a merevlemezektől eltérő

tulajdonságai vannak. Ennek megfelelően a háttértáron használt

állományrendszer megválasztásakor meg kell vizsgálni, hogy a speciális

követelményeknek (robusztusság, tartósság), mennyire felelnek meg az

egyes fájlrendszerek.

Jelen dolgozatban a követelmények részletes bemutatása után megvizsgálok

néhány állományrendszert, hogy mennyire és hogyan felelnek meg

a követelményeknek. Az összehasonlítás részeként a teljesítményüket egy

Raspberry Pi-on mérem meg. Ennek kapcsán bemutatom egy egyszerű

beágyazott Linux alapú rendszer létrehozásának és testreszabásának

menetét.

Letölthető fájlok

A témához tartozó fájlokat csak bejelentkezett felhasználók tölthetik le.